The goal is to transform a flat square sheet of paper into a completed sculpture as a result of folding and sculpting methods. Present day origami practitioners commonly discourage using cuts, glue, or markings on the paper. Origami folders frequently make use of the Japanese term kirigami to check with styles which use cuts.

It's not selected when Participate in-produced paper versions, now usually referred to as origami, started in Japan. On the other hand, the kozuka of the Japanese sword made by Obtainedō Eijō (後藤栄乗) concerning the tip with the 1500s and the start of the 1600s was decorated with a picture of a crane fabricated from origami, and it can be believed that origami for Perform existed with the Sengoku period of time or maybe the early Edo period.[5]
